Our God is a jealous God. Why then shouldn't humans also be jealous? Why are we not allowed to be jealous?

God has the right to be jealous when we turn to the devil or to sin, because Ps. 100:3d says that "it is He that made us, and not we ourselves; we are His people and the sheep of His pasture". Hence we are his property; his creation. We need to do what He tells and wants us to do, and not what we want to do; like staying away from Him.

We should not be jealous of others because what they have was given to them rightfully by God; or He allowed them to attain it, whether by fair or foul means. God knows exactly how to deal with everyone. Being jealous of others is equivalent to grieving over what God has allowed others to have. It should not be so. We were created in God's image, hence the feeling of jealousy can come about, but we can control it by His grace.

Cain got jealous of his brother Abel and killed him. That should not be our behaviour. We should ask for God's grace to control jealousy, and He will supply.
